Transaction 77b097aa6425b00c603e61aee5e0e784d8c1368029ddb2d84cf06a6ebb233e94
1 Input
1 Output
-
77b097aa6425b00c603e61aee5e0e784d8c1368029ddb2d84cf06a6ebb233e94:0
- value
- 310306
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f582cb86a37259590642fecd687abaa8983357d
- address
- bc1qeavzewr2xujetyry9lkddpat42ycxdtazdzfe7